如何创建流式 Web api?或者我们可以实施哪种技术来在 .NET 中创建流 api?

How to create streaming Web api? or which techonology we can implement to create streaming api in .NET?

我需要 API 将实时数据流式传输到 UI(UI 可能是 React 或 angular 应用程序)。一旦我调用服务器,它应该继续以 JSON 格式提供实时数据。例如,交易应用程序中的 Blotter 屏幕等应用程序

哪种技术更适合创造这种API?

看看 WebSockets 和 ASP.NET Core SignalR

https://docs.microsoft.com/en-us/aspnet/core/fundamentals/websockets?view=aspnetcore-3.1

SignalR 是最方便使用的技术。